Transaction 595264bc61f33367b6e820c04128b74503c087b69226eb1da6610ded59cf147b
1 Input
1 Output
-
595264bc61f33367b6e820c04128b74503c087b69226eb1da6610ded59cf147b:0
- value
- 2612757
- script pubkey
- OP_0 OP_PUSHBYTES_20 532a0ab8628df843f722e9f201d293ac1ff4280e
- address
- bc1q2v4q4wrz3huy8aeza8eqr55n4s0lg2qwz0gwyj